Campaigns that have no impression cap.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/adwordsgirl\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@adwordsgirl<\/a><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\">D<\/span><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\">efer to my upcoming presentation at <\/span><span class=\"r-18u37iz\"><a class=\"css-4rbku5 css-18t94o4 css-901oao css-16my406 r-1n1174f r-1loqt21 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" dir=\"ltr\" role=\"link\" href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/DigitalSummits\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\" data-focusable=\"true\">@DigitalSummits<\/a>\u00a0<\/span>&#8220;Don&#8217;t Blame the Vendor Because Your Ad Placement Makes You Look Like a Horrible Person&#8221;.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/JonKagan\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@JonKagan<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Q5: Do you have any kind of standard practice you use when setting up remarketing campaigns?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>CHECK MCF IN ANALYTICS Reference &#8211; Time Lag Report &#8211; Path Length Report Create audience windows\/ funnels accordingly!!!! <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/markpgus\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@markpgus<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Almost every campaign is set up custom for the objective. Almost always exclude converters unless we are selling an upgrade\/new version or something though.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/Mel66\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@Mel66<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Impression cap! Don&#8217;t be that guy.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/ValenciaSEM\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@ValenciaSEM<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Setting time limits. Excluding audiences. Have 2 ads, one for the cognitive route and one for the affective route.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/AskYisrael\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@AskYisrael<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Yes! get yourself a checklist, first. Next, set up the reason for your remarketing. Is it form dropoffs? repeat store visits? Next, exclude your converters (or at least limit the time between visits), build new creative, and label label label everything! <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/JuliaVyse\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@JuliaVyse<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Negative audiences. Just like embedded negative kws for search &#8211; if we are targeting a remarketing audience in one campaign\/ad set, we better be excluding it from others! Also, tracking and excluding people who convert so they aren&#8217;t hit up twice.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/akaEmmaLouise\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@akaEmmaLouise<\/a><\/p>\n<p>I am all aboard the segmenting train. If things are not set up to be easily segmented into the audiences we need, I get to work on that FIRST. Also, I often like a series of ads, not just one.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/NeptuneMoon\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@NeptuneMoon<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Totally seconded on the series. Put them in a series of audiences with different ads and different offers.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/CJSlattery\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@CJSlattery<\/a><\/p>\n<p>I try find platforms that allow for smaller sizes or find other ways. Sometimes I&#8217;ll still create a campaign and see what happens anyway.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/AskYisrael\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@AskYisrael<\/a><\/p>\n<p><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\"> Don&#8217;t ignore placements. Make sure your audience\/placements are brand safe.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/JonKagan\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@JonKagan<\/a><\/span><\/p>\n<p>With Facebook remarketing, show to all placements and then exclude the placements once you have some data and know what&#8217;s converting well <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/chloevarns\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@chloevarns<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Segmenting and several variations of the ads.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/adwordsgirl\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@adwordsgirl<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\">Q6: How do you handle <\/span><span class=\"r-18u37iz\"><a class=\"css-4rbku5 css-18t94o4 css-901oao css-16my406 r-1n1174f r-1loqt21 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" dir=\"ltr\" role=\"link\" href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/hashtag\/remarketing?src=hashtag_click\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\" data-focusable=\"true\">#remarketing<\/a><\/span><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\"> with small audiences\/too small to remarket? <\/span><\/strong><\/h4>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>This is where I&#8217;m torn. Still trying to find a work around for this! <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/chloevarns\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@chloevarns<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Q8: What do you wish clients knew\/did with their web sites to make remarketing easier?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>Let me pixel the site? and if not, make those category pages clear and simple. the funnel shouldn&#8217;t be a star chart, it should be clear.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/JuliaVyse\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@JuliaVyse<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Use separate URLs and don&#8217;t have things reload in the same page\/URL. Tracking is SO MUCH EASIER when you have separate URLs. Fill out a form? Go to a thank you page. Complete a purchase? Go to a thank you\/confirmation page. Make unique pages for remkt. ads too.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/NeptuneMoon\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@NeptuneMoon<\/a><\/p>\n<p>That they can&#8217;t just remarket back to the same page and it&#8217;ll be all good. And I wish they would setup within their analytics funnel stages so that remarketing can deal with each independently and consciously.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/AskYisrael\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@AskYisrael<\/a><\/p>\n<p>If you have a service and a lot of pages\/blogs about that particular service &#8211; to remarket to people interested in that service and not the others you offer &#8211; make them have something in the URL in common = easier to group them in an audience. Also no iframes.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/amaliaefowler\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@amaliaefowler<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Create specific LPs addressing the pain points I\u2019m addressing in the ads! Also nice for building funnels when you can send them to a typical LP and optimize to a lower level event like VC or ATC which requires site navigation.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/markpgus\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@markpgus<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Categorize URLS so I can just use a URL contains \u201csub folder\u201d <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/markpgus\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@markpgus<\/a><\/p>\n<p><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\">Grant me Google Tag Manager access. So many fun remarketing opportunities (see my recent slides on the topic: <\/span><a class=\"css-4rbku5 css-18t94o4 css-901oao css-16my406 r-1n1174f r-1loqt21 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" dir=\"ltr\" title=\"https:\/\/www.hanapinmarketing.com\/google-tag-manager\/\" role=\"link\" href=\"https:\/\/t.co\/u5xAWwKXjN?amp=1\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" data-focusable=\"true\"><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-hiw28u r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" aria-hidden=\"true\">https:\/\/<\/span>hanapinmarketing.com\/google-tag-man<span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-hiw28u r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" aria-hidden=\"true\">ager\/<\/span><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-lrvibr r-qvutc0\" aria-hidden=\"true\">\u2026<\/span><\/a><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\">). <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/akaEmmaLouise\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@akaEmmaLouise<\/a><\/span><\/p>\n<p>3 LOAD FASTER!!!! <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/markpgus\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@markpgus<\/a><\/p>\n<p><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\"> Single page sites are fun and cute and all, but a nightmare for trying to build audience behavior lists off. Make your sites digestable, deep, and navitgable but not overwhelming.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/JonKagan\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@JonKagan<\/a><\/span><\/p>\n<p>Also businesses within other businesses (i.e. restaurants within hotels) &#8211; make sure you can track separately! <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/amaliaefowler\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@amaliaefowler<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Also a smaller note but if you are a franchise or have stores in several locations and each have a website, don&#8217;t make the form common for them all. That means we track ALL forms, not one. I wish more people knew to think about this when building businesses.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/amaliaefowler\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@amaliaefowler<\/a><\/p>\n<p>Have an app with some content, not just purchases. those deep links help build a whole owned channel of yours right on people&#8217;s phones! make that app sing! <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/JuliaVyse\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@JuliaVyse<\/a><\/p>\n<p><span class=\"css-901oao css-16my406 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\">I think it was <\/span><span class=\"r-18u37iz\"><a class=\"css-4rbku5 css-18t94o4 css-901oao css-16my406 r-1n1174f r-1loqt21 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" dir=\"ltr\" role=\"link\" href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/michellemsem\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\" data-focusable=\"true\">@michellemsem<\/a>\u00a0<\/span>at\u00a0<span class=\"r-18u37iz\"><a class=\"css-4rbku5 css-18t94o4 css-901oao css-16my406 r-1n1174f r-1loqt21 r-1qd0xha r-ad9z0x r-bcqeeo r-qvutc0\" dir=\"ltr\" role=\"link\" href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/heroconf\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\" data-focusable=\"true\">@heroconf<\/a>\u00a0<\/span>that talked about the &#8220;price&#8221; of your offer (i.e. amount of data you&#8217;re requiring in exchange). If you&#8217;re retargeting someone who didn&#8217;t convert, lower the &#8220;price&#8221; (fewer form fields) or increase the value they receive.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/akaEmmaLouise\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@akaEmmaLouise<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Q9: Is there a feature or capability you wish was available for remarketing that currently is not available?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>I realize this will likely never happen but I really wish third party booking systems like open table and jane app allowed for GTM\/Analytics installs &#8211; we can&#8217;t exclude audiences that convert this way, and its bad remarketing. <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/amaliaefowler\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">@amaliaefowler<\/a><\/p>\n<p>LET ME PULL NONCOOKIE BASED DATA INTO AN ATTRIBUTION TOOL AND LET ME PUSH THOSE AUDIENCES OUT ON OTHER PLATFORMS But&#8230;.
